GOVERNING BODY Vidya Sagar College for Girls (Sangrur) is governed by the management committee of Bhagat Namdev Educational & Charitable Trust, Dhuri (Pb.). The society is a registered body registered under Society Registration Act (XXI) of 1860. The society has members consisting of educationists and eminent personalities as Chairman, Managing Director of the Society. The society is non-profit making body and is fed by guidance of Punjab's famous 'Modern Secular Educational Society, Dhuri' well known for the services in the field of education.
